INT. SOUTH FERRY STATION. BRIEFING ROOM. DAY.
We cut straight in to the bustle of a briefing.
There’s an audience of 17 police officers, all
in uniform (1 Inspector + 2 Sergeants + 14 PCs),
many still getting their bullet-proof jackets
on, one or two still filling in at the back to
make the total number.
Enter the Strategic Firearms Commander (SFC) -TERRY
REYNOLDS. Behind him a screen that shows a
city map.
UNIFORMED OFFICERS all stand to attention as he
enters. He signals them to sit.
REYNOLDS:
Okay. Thank you.
A uniformed bullet-proof-vested Sergeant sits
near the front, making notes in a pad with an
air of cool professionalism. This is SERGEANT
DANNY WALDRON.
REYNOLDS (CONT’D)
Operation Damson is an on-going
initiative aimed at detection slash
prevention of gangland murders.
Surveillance of a suspect under
Operation Damson has been in place
at an address for less than 24
hours, with intelligence sources
indicating a significant belief the
suspect is preparing to commit a
gangland execution –
C/U DANNY WALDRON. Close to Danny sit 3 PCs
HARINDERPAL “HARI” BAINS, PC ROD KENNEDY, PC
JACKIE BRICKFORD.
REYNOLDS (CONT’D)(O.S)
The suspect is a known criminal
with a history of violence. He is
expected to be armed...
